WebSilicosis is a lung disease.It usually happens in jobs where you breathe in dust that contains silica. That’s a tiny crystal found in sand, rock, or mineral ores like quartz. WebMay 24, 2024 · Thus, protein crystals may promote hallmark features of asthma and are targetable by crystal-dissolving antibodies. Asthma is a chronic inflammatory disease characterized by the influx of type 2 immune cells, such as eosinophils, T helper type 2 cells, mast cells, and basophils, into the airways.
